
Over four months, Isyuzev contributed to the JinOptimist/NET21Online repository by building and enhancing features that improved both user experience and code reliability. He developed a Space News Management System with end-to-end article workflows, integrated ISS tracking using external APIs, and implemented personalized user interfaces. His technical approach emphasized robust backend development in C# and ASP.NET Core, leveraging Entity Framework Core for data persistence and validation. Isyuzev also strengthened test coverage through unit and end-to-end testing with NUnit and Selenium, refactoring code for maintainability and adopting dependency injection. His work addressed content lifecycle efficiency, test reliability, and seamless API integration.

October 2025 monthly performance summary for JinOptimist/NET21Online. Delivered two major features with a strong focus on test reliability and external API integration. Space News End-to-End Testing Enhancements expanded test coverage for creating, validating, deleting news entries, with UI adjustments; selectors and wait times refactored to improve reliability. ISS Tracking Feature integrated an external API to fetch ISS position, compute distance from user location, and present it in the UI, enabling location-based distance calculations. No production bugs closed this month; emphasis was on stabilizing the test suite and expanding capabilities to drive faster, safer releases.

August 2025: Delivered two major capabilities in JinOptimist/NET21Online that drive content lifecycle efficiency and personalized UX. The Space News Management System provides end-to-end article creation, display, persistence, author attribution, and UI integration, with backend data validation and readiness for broader content workflows. A parallel effort added a Personalized Welcome and Last Visit on the Space Station index to enhance user engagement through backend logic and UI changes. These efforts were carried out through a series of incremental commits (e.g., DB connected; Title uniq name validation + input rules validation; welcome message + last visit HTML side). Impact includes streamlined content lifecycle, improved data quality, and higher user engagement. Technologies demonstrated include .NET/C#, EF Core, backend logic, and UI integration, with strong emphasis on validation patterns.

July 2025 monthly summary for JinOptimist/NET21Online. Focused on strengthening test coverage and testability for the maze game. Delivered a cohesive package of unit tests targeting EvilSpirit and Shield, refactored constructors to accept an IMazeMap interface for improved dependency injection, and modernized test patterns and assertions. Removed unused mocks, adopted Arrange-Act-Assert conventions, and added a dedicated test to verify Shield HP increase logic under edge cases (including potential negative HP). No production bugs reported this month; primary impact was building a robust testing foundation to enable faster, safer feature delivery and lower regression risk.
